获取设备绑定的网关信息
此接口用于获取设备绑定的网关信息。
1 接口路径
GET /api/v1/device/{deviceId}/gateway_info
2 请求参数
路径参数:
| 名称 | 类型 | 是否必需 | 描述 | 
|---|---|---|---|
| deviceId | BigInteger | 是 | 设备ID | 
3 返回参数
统一返回参数说明参考:公共参数,以下是返回业务参数(data)的说明:
| 名称 | 类型 | 描述 | 
|---|---|---|
| id | BigInteger | 网关ID | 
| name | String | 网关设备名称 | 
| productKey | String | 网关所属产品key | 
| productName | String | 网关所属产品的名称 | 
| status | String | 网关设备状态,可选: UN_ACTIVE、ONLINE、OFFLINE、FORBIDDEN、ENABLE | 
| firmwareVersion | String | 固件版本 | 
| ip | String | 网关IP | 
| latelyOnlineTime | Long | 网关最近上线时间 | 
| activationTime | Long | 网关激活时间 | 
| createTime | Long | 网关创建时间 | 
4 返回状态码
公共状态码说明参考:公共参数,以下是业务关联的状态码说明:
| code | 描述 | 
|---|---|
| 120125 | 该设备未绑定网关 | 
5 示例
请求示例
/api/v1/device/297161370850443264/gateway_info
返回示例
{
    "code": "000000",
    "data": {
        "id": "301419944438996992",
        "name": "HUB-1",
        "ip": "172.18.167.38",
        "firmwareVersion": "",
        "status": "OFFLINE",
        "productKey": "0_9a1bf3b4492",
        "productName": "我的网关类产品",
        "activationTime": 1562835034000,
        "latelyOnlineTime": 1562835034000,
        "createTime": 1562835034000
    },
    "message": "success"
}